从定义到实践:学会在 C++ 中使用变量
什么是变量?不只是一个储存值的盒子
想象一下,如果把程序比作一个厨房,那么变量就像是厨房里的容器。我们不会直接用手指去抓盐、糖或者面粉,而是将它们放在不同的容器里,以便随时取用。同样地,在编程世界中,变量就是用来存储数据的容器。它不仅仅是一个存放数值的地方,更是让程序能够动态变化和互动的核心元素。
在C++中,要声明一个变量,就像告诉厨师我们需要什么类型的容器以及它的大小。例如,int age = 25;
这行代码不仅创建了一个名为 age
的整数类型(int
)变量,还给它赋了初值25。这里,age
就像是一个标签,标记着这个特定的“容器”,让我们可以在需要的时候轻松找到它并使用其中的数据。
变量类型大揭秘:整数、浮点数、字符与布尔
继续我们的厨房比喻,不同类型的食材需要不同类型的容器来保存。同样的道理,C++ 提供了多种变量类型以适应不同的需求。整数变量(int
)非常适合用来计数,比如记录年龄或人数;而当涉及到金钱计算或科学运算时,浮点数变量(float
或 double
)则提供了必要的精度,确保每一个小数点后的数字都准确无误。
字符变量(char
)则是构成文本的基本单位,每一个字母、符号都可以被单独存储。至于布尔变量(bool
),它就像是开关,只有两种状态——开或关,真或假,这在控制程序逻辑流程时显得尤为重要。
int peopleCount = 100; // 记录人数
float pi = 3.14f; // 存储圆周率
char initial = 'A'; // 字母A
bool isOnline = true; // 状态指示